Tasked to empower the financial well-being of women, Dr. Loretta Sarpong is seeking to motivate women – led businesses into giant and profitable entities.
Her role at Ecobank Ghana mainly focuses on providing tailor made financial and non-financial support to women who own businesses in the country, businesses managed by women in Ghana, institutions with one-third of their employees being women, among others
“I want to be growing and contributing towards human development, impacting not only this generation, but the next one to come. So I keep learning and adding onto knowledge, seeking to be a better version of myself! I’m a ‘toastmaster’, seeking to improve my leadership and communication skills on daily basis!”, Dr. Sarpong described herself.
This is how she chooses to describe herself in her bio; a selfless being who seeks to impact her generation and beyond.
She heads the women’s desk at Ecobank Ghana Limited, serving in the banking industry for about two decades now, having risen through the ranks.
Her vast experience in banking encompasses retail banking, corporate banking, relationship banking and branch management. Indeed, she served as branch manager for eight years before her appointment as head of the women’s desk.
Today, Joy Business Ghana throws the spotlight on her.
Dr. Loretta Sarpong is a member of several chartered organisations and groups both locally and internationally. Notable amongst them are the Chartered Institute of Administration Ghana (CIAMG), Association of The Certified Chartered Economists (ACCE-US) and the International Professional Management Association (UK). She also serves as one of the directors of Ghana Toastmasters, a non-profit organization that teaches public speaking and leadership through a network of clubs.
She holds a PhD in Management from the Texila American University and MBA from the Paris Graduate School of Management.
She is also a proud Teknokrat (KNUST), graduating with a first degree in Planning (Development Policy Option).
